Diploma in Advanced Computer Arts (DACA) at MET Institute of Information Technology in Mumbai, Maharashtra, is a one-year full-time program designed for students who have completed their 10+2 education. The course offers specialized training in digital art, graphic design, animation, and multimedia technologies, with a total fee of ₹1 lakh. Students gain hands-on experience through projects, workshops, and industry-oriented assignments, developing creativity and technical proficiency. The program emphasizes practical skills, artistic expression, and professional readiness to prepare graduates for careers in digital media and creative industries. Graduates are equipped to pursue roles in animation, graphic design, multimedia production, and other computer arts fields.

Post Graduate Diploma in Advanced Computing (PG-DAC) at MET Institute of Information Technology in Mumbai, Maharashtra, is a full-time program designed for graduates with at least 50% marks. The course offers in-depth training in advanced computing, software development, programming, and emerging IT technologies, with a total fee of ₹90,000. Students gain hands-on experience through projects, labs, and industry-oriented assignments, preparing them for careers in IT, software services, and technology innovation. The program emphasizes problem-solving, analytical thinking, and practical skills to enhance professional readiness. Graduates are equipped to pursue roles in software development, data analysis, system design, and other technology-driven fields.
